The Senior Analyst, Field Operations Procedure Analyst will be supporting the various LOBs within the Consumer Bank is responsible for producing effective written procedures and resources. They will partner with SME’s from the various LOBs to analyze, recommend, author and deliver high-quality documentation to ensure a consistent approach to the management of all procedures within the Consumer Bank.

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for guiding and mentoring colleagues on the development and updates of documented procedures in H2W for all Consumer Bank Segments
  • Ensure procedures are up to date and compliant with banking regulations. 
  • Assist with the creation of internal procedures for high-risk job functions within each segment.
  • Facilitate a regular cadence of meetings with relevant stakeholders and SMEs to discuss procedures coming up for annual review/ any upcoming initiatives that will require procedures to be developed.
  • Coordinate the distribution of documents and forms for updates as needed.
  • Provide monthly reporting to include completed/ coming due for annual review.
  • Draft and send communications as needed.
  • Develop and maintain relationships with all relevant stakeholders & SME’s.
  • Build upon and develop a deep understanding of the various roles and responsibilities within each segment/ the function of the segment.
  • Represent Field Operations & The Consumer Bank on various projects and initiatives.

EXPERIENCE

  • 3 years or more of banking experience preferred. 3 years procedure writing, and oversight preferred.
  • In depth knowledge of banking practices and regulations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ite and other standard banking programs.
  • Ability to work under pressure and handle multiple tasks. Must have highly developed written and verbal communication skills.
  • Must have excellent organization, and analytical skills.
  • Must be able to demonstrate successful change and project management

Webster is a leading commercial bank that delivers financial solutions to business, individuals, families and partners. With more than $60 billion in assets, we offer digital and traditional service delivery through our differentiated lines of business: Commercial Banking, Consumer Banking and HSA Bank, one of the country’s largest providers of employee benefits solutions.
